Tab management extensions are an area where the webextensions API is still being worked on. Eventually some tab extensions may come out, but they are likely not to be the first ones ready when Firefox 57 rolls out.

If all you want from cookie management is a whitelist for cookies to keep, and to allow all other cookies but dump them after every session, that can be done with the built in Firefox features. Set cookies default to "allow for session" and make exceptions only for the ones you want to keep. If you want different then that try this one: https://addons.mozilla.org/en-US/firefo ... utodelete/

Download statusbar as a UI changing type of extension is the kind that is likely to never come back. For speed dial see: https://addons.mozilla.org/en-US/firefo ... dial-lite/

Download Star is what is being recommended for DownThemAll, although it does not have every feature (such as acceleration) https://addons.mozilla.org/en-US/firefo ... load-star/

the outdated "signed-signed" crap is already dead, author hat dropped it 5 years ago. definetly no update. some are deleted.
at least firefox/servo has reduced user impact on its settings or pages, forget all, what you currently havem start from scratch which is best.

and forget the chromify crap - firefox extensions are nearly same but without a propper conversion none (or very very few only) of them would run.
what you really should forget is a decent tab management. TMP itself wont get WE, the api is missing and wont be inserted. you have to replace it in parts and then you will miss alot.
